Janzen Jackson Unexpectedly Picks Tennessee over LSU

The No. 2 ranked cornerback in the United States, Janzen Jackson, has dealt a blow to LSU recruiting roster for '09 by picking Tennessee as his school of choice for this upcoming football season.

 

Previously he had committed to LSU about a year ago, but then changed his mind and signed with Tennessee this morning:

 

"It was a very tough decision," Jackson said after choosing Tennessee at the Barbe coaches' office. "But Louisiana will always be my home."


Jackson also said the loss of LSU co-defensive coordinator Bradley Dale Peveto impacted his decision. Peveto, who recruited Jackson, was let go after the Tigers' disappointing 2008 season on defense and became the head coach at Northwestern State.
